Why does the Chevy Silverado 1500 transmission cost more?
A used Chevy Silverado 1500 transmission carries a median asking price of $2,510, which is 54% higher than the Nissan Pathfinder at $1,630. Supply also plays a role: Chevy Silverado 1500 has 4,985 priced listings versus 1,983 for Nissan Pathfinder, and more listings generally mean more choices and more competitive pricing.
Grade A (excellent condition) parts make up 68% of Nissan Pathfinder listings compared to 51% for the Chevy Silverado 1500, so buyers looking for top-condition units will find more options on the Nissan Pathfinder side.
At Grade A (excellent) condition, the Nissan Pathfinder is 27% cheaper ($1,839 vs $2,505) — the gap narrows compared to the overall median difference.
Buyer's checklist
What to check before buying a used transmission
- Match the exact transmission ID stamped on the case — the same vehicle can use different units depending on engine, drivetrain, and gear ratio.
- Ask if the transmission was tested before removal. Fluid color matters: red/pink is healthy, brown or burnt-smelling fluid signals internal wear.
- Confirm whether a torque converter (automatic) or clutch kit (manual) is included. Replacing these separately adds $150–$400.
- Check the warranty: reputable yards offer 30–90 days on transmissions. Avoid any with no warranty at all.

Can I use a Chevy Silverado 1500 transmission in a Nissan Pathfinder?
This comparison describes pricing, not interchangeability. Even when two parts share similar prices, they may require different engines, trims, electronics, or mounting points. Always match the seller's part number against your VIN before purchasing.
